The Mid-Prairie Golden Hawk boys wrestling team traveled to their final weekend tournament of the regular season, finishing eighth at North Tama Saturday. The Hawks scored 64 points, Riceville won the meet with 167.5. At 215lbs, Tommy Miller headlined the event for the Hawks, winning the individual title. Miller pinned his way to the championship including a finals fall in just 30 seconds. Other top performers included Burke Berry runner-up at 285lbs, Brock Fisher third at 215 and Parker English at 120 and Max Kipp at 157 both fourth.

Mid-Prairie will next be in action Saturday at the River Valley Conference Championships at West Liberty.
